#3882de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3882de is composed of 22% red, 51%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.8% cyan, 41.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 213.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.6% and a lightness of 54.5%. #3882de color hex could be obtained by blending #70ffff with #0005bd.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#3882de

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000203 is the darkest color, while #f1f6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3882de

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888b8e is the less saturated color, while #1d7ff9 is the most saturated one.
